Understanding Scale Buildup

Scale buildup in hot tubs refers to the accumulation of mineral deposits, primarily consisting of calcium, magnesium, and other dissolved solids, on the surfaces and components of the hot tub system. The primary causes of scale formation in hot tubs include:

  1. Mineral Content in Water: Hot tubs filled with “hard water” that contains high levels of dissolved minerals, such as calcium and magnesium, are more prone to scale buildup. As the water evaporates, these minerals are left behind and cling to the hot tub surfaces.
  2. High Water Temperatures: The high temperatures maintained in hot tubs, typically between 100-104°F, accelerate the rate of mineral precipitation and scale formation. The warmer the water, the more rapidly the minerals can combine and adhere to surfaces.
  3. Lack of Proper Water Treatment: Inadequate water testing, balancing, and the use of appropriate chemical treatments can contribute to scale buildup. Maintaining proper pH, and alkalinity, and the use of scale inhibitors can help prevent scale formation. 

Identifying Calcified Mechanical Parts

  1. Heating Elements: Scale buildup can affect the heating elements in hot tubs, leading to reduced efficiency, increased energy consumption, and potential equipment failure. The accumulation of scale on heating elements can hinder their performance and longevity.
  2. Pumps and Impellers: Scale buildup can also impact the pumps and impellers in hot tubs. The presence of scale on these components can reduce water flow, decrease pump efficiency, and potentially lead to breakdowns. Regular maintenance and cleaning are essential to prevent scale-related issues in pumps and impellers.
  3. Valves and Jets: Valves and jets are susceptible to scale buildup in hot tubs. The accumulation of minerals on these components can restrict water flow, affect water pressure, and impact the overall hydrotherapy experience. Proper cleaning and maintenance of valves and jets are necessary to prevent scale-related problems. Check out the hot tub jet not working article.
  4. Filters and Plumbing: Scale buildup can also affect the filters and plumbing of hot tubs. Clogged filters due to scale accumulation can reduce water circulation and filtration efficiency.
Additionally, scale in the plumbing can lead to blockages and decreased water flow. Regular cleaning and maintenance of filters and plumbing are essential to prevent scale-related issues.

Impacts of Calcified Mechanical Parts

  1. Reduced Efficiency and Performance: Scale buildup on critical components like heating elements, pumps, and jets can impair their functionality, leading to reduced efficiency and overall performance of the hot tub system. 
  2. Increased Energy Consumption: The reduced efficiency caused by scale buildup can result in the hot tub’s heating elements and other components working harder to maintain the desired water temperature, leading to increased energy consumption and higher operating costs.
  3. Potential Equipment Failure and Breakdowns: Heavily calcified parts, such as pumps, valves, and impellers, are at a higher risk of premature failure and breakdowns, which can disrupt the normal operation of the hot tub and require costly repairs or replacements. 
  4. Decreased Lifespan of Hot Tub Components: The accumulation of scale on various hot tub components can accelerate their wear and tear, leading to a shorter overall lifespan of the affected parts and the need for more frequent replacements.

Preventative Measures and Maintenance Tips

  1. Regular Water Testing and Balancing: It is essential to regularly test and balance the water in your hot tub to ensure that pH, alkalinity, and sanitizer levels are within the recommended range. This helps prevent issues like scale buildup and ensures a safe and enjoyable hot tub experience. 
  2. Use of Water Softeners or Scale Inhibitors: Incorporating water softeners or scale inhibitors can help reduce the mineral content in the water, minimizing the risk of scale formation on hot tub components. These products can prolong the lifespan of the hot tub and reduce maintenance costs.
  3. Proper Chemical Treatment and Sanitization: Maintaining proper chemical treatment and sanitization is crucial for keeping the hot tub water clean and free from harmful bacteria. Following manufacturer guidelines for the use of sanitizers like bromine or chlorine is essential for water quality and preventing scale buildup. 
  4. Routine Cleaning and Maintenance of Hot Tub Components: Regular cleaning and maintenance of hot tub components, such as filters, pumps, valves, and jets, are necessary to prevent scale accumulation and ensure the efficient operation of the hot tub. Cleaning the hot tub shell and filter cartridge helps prevent the growth of algae and mold. 
  5. Importance of Professional Servicing and Inspections: Periodic professional servicing and inspections are recommended to identify any potential issues early on and ensure that the hot tub is functioning optimally.

Troubleshooting and Addressing Scale Buildup

Identifying Signs of Scale Buildup:

  • Presence of white, chalky, or yellow flakes floating in the hot tub water.
  • Rough, sandpaper-like feel on the hot tub surfaces.
  • Buildup of a creamy white or chalky substance on fixtures, jets, and other components.

Steps to Remove and Prevent Scale Buildup:

  1. Reduce Calcium Buildup:
    • Use scale inhibitor products like Sundance® Spas Protect Plus.
    • Install a high-quality water filter to reduce mineral content.
  2. Test and Adjust Alkalinity:
    • Test the water’s pH and alkalinity levels regularly.
    • Use products to adjust alkalinity to the recommended range (80-120 ppm).
  3. Routine Cleaning and Maintenance:
    • Drain, clean, and refill the hot tub every 3-6 months.
    • Scrub the hot tub surfaces to remove existing scale buildup.
    • Use scale-removing products and elbow grease to break up and remove the scale.
    • Regularly clean and maintain the filters.

Replacement of Heavily Calcified Parts:

  • If the scale buildup is severe and cannot be removed through cleaning, replacement of heavily calcified parts, such as heating elements, pumps, and valves, may be necessary
